Acting the relationship anywhere between wolf handle and you may cattle depredation

Wolf handle to minimize cattle depredation is a vital thing so you’re able to ecology and you may agriculture in the usa. Several recent documents utilize the same dataset with wolf inhabitants attributes and you will cows depredation, however, started to face-to-face findings in regards to the outcomes of wolf control and you will cattle depredation. Our paper aims to eliminate this dilemma utilizing the same dataset and you can development a design centered on a good causal relationship one carry out explain the nature of dating ranging from wolf manage and you will cattle depredation. We use the analysis on wolf populace, number of cattle, quantity of wolves murdered and number of cattle killed, on U.S. Fish and you can Creatures Characteristics Interagency Yearly Wolf Accounts over the months of 1987–2012. We find a confident link between wolf manage and you will cows depredation. Although not, it could be completely wrong in order to infer one wolf handle provides an effective self-confident effect on just how many cattle depredated. I take care of that this connect arises from navigieren Sie zu diesen Jungs an ever growing wolf population, and therefore grows cows depredation, and as a result, grounds a rise in exactly how many wolves slain. As the wolf inhabitants keeps growing, we come across each other wolf elimination and cows depredation additionally build. This is simply not up until the wolf people growth nears the fresh constant state, that removal of wolves features a sufficient bad impression to reduce otherwise balance out exactly how many cows depredated.

Inclusion

The difficulty regarding wolf control to minimize animals depredation features an very important devote agricultural and environmental literary works. Deleting wolves could be said to assist ranchers reduce the livestock loss by way of a reduction in this new wolf-cattle relationships. A couple of previous files (Wielgus and you can Peebles , and you may Poudyal et al. ) make use of the exact same dataset to draw opposing conclusions regarding feeling out of wolf control towards the cattle depredation. Our very own report centers around resolving the same condition, and you will attempts to influence the real matchmaking between wolf manage and you will cattle depredation.

Wolf control as well as outcomes try a significant material regarding western All of us. In response in order to depredations on the livestock and animals, gray wolves (Canis lupus) was essentially extirpated from the western U.S. by 1930s. During the 1973, the brand new grey wolf received security according to the Endangered Kinds Act, that can applied the floor work with the desired recuperation from the fresh new variety. In the early mid-eighties, Canadian grey wolves began colonizing new northwestern percentage of Montana and you can by the 1987, there have been an estimated 10 gray wolves into the Montana. When you look at the 1995, gray wolves was basically reintroduced so you can Yellowstone National Park located at the fresh new limitations out-of Montana, Idaho and Wyoming. Seventeen age later, Montana, Wyoming and you may Idaho had a projected 625, 277 and you may 683 wolves, respectively. The brand new quick recuperation from wolves of near extinction throughout the 1980s to the current amount of over step one,five hundred wolves in the west You suggests the fresh new versatility of those pet. Understand the U.S. Service off Fairness page to own the real history of your gray wolf regarding western U.S. .

To your boost in wolf numbers on west U.S., there were a matching escalation in cows and you can sheep depredation because of wolves. In 1995, the season wolves were introduced on the Yellowstone Federal Playground, simply three cows and no sheep were slain from the wolves into the Montana, Wyoming and you will Idaho, while in 2012, Montana, Wyoming and Idaho forgotten 67, 49 and you may 73 cattle, correspondingly, just like the exact same around three claims in addition to missing 37, 112 and you may 312 sheep, correspondingly. Away from reintroduction until 2012, wolf removals on account of depredation was basically mainly the responsibility of one’s United states Fish and you may Creatures Solution otherwise state wildlife organizations. In 2009, trapping and recreation 12 months to possess wolves was in fact started in the Montana, Wyoming and you may Idaho, even though the grey wolf was then relisted since an endangered varieties for the Wyoming.
